I suspect at some point in the future we may need to have a
combination of "fast Travis CI builds" and more exhaustive / longer
running builds in Jenkins. Projects like Apache Kudu have much more
intense testing procedures and these are run on dedicated
infrastructure rather than CI

I also think that more parts of our CI could be handled by creating an
"Arrow test bot" that can respond to directions. There are a number of
frameworks and examples now for writing GitHub bots; we could create a
bot that can execute on-demand tests of optional components using the
crossbow tool.

Other things that we run in every commit, like the Python manylinux1
build, could be run on-demand and nightly. That being said, I just
worked on a PR that broke the manylinux1 build
(https://github.com/apache/arrow/pull/2428) and so we risk having to
hunt down the root cause of a broken build if we don't run such tests
on every commit. I'm not sure we can simultaneously have fast CI
builds while also catching all possible problems

>>> We should also discuss if we want to continue to build and test Python
>>> 3.5. From download statistics it appears that there are 5-10x as many
>>> Python 3.6 users as 3.5. I would prefer to drop 3.5 and begin
>>> supporting 3.7 soon.
>>>
>>> @Antoine, I think we can avoid building the C++ codebase 3 times, but
>>> it will require a bit of retooling of the scripts. The reason that
>>> ccache isn't working properly is probably because the Python include
>>> directory is being included even for compilation units that do not use
>>> the Python C API.
